Photovoltaic system repair services involve diagnosing and fixing issues that may impair the performance of solar energy systems. Technicians assess components such as panels, inverters, wiring, and mounting hardware to identify faults or damage. Common repairs include replacing malfunctioning inverters, repairing damaged wiring, addressing shading or soiling on panels, and fixing loose or corroded connections. These services help restore optimal energy production and ensure the longevity of the solar installation, allowing property owners to maintain efficient and reliable solar power systems.
Many problems that lead to the need for photovoltaic system repairs stem from environmental exposure, aging components, or installation issues. Over time, panels may develop microcracks or become dirty, reducing their efficiency. Inverters can fail or malfunction, disrupting energy conversion from direct current to usable alternating current. Wiring and connections may degrade or become loose, causing system interruptions or safety hazards. Repair services help resolve these issues promptly, preventing further damage and ensuring that the system continues to operate at peak performance.

Cost of Repair Services - Typical costs for photovoltaic system repairs range from $300 to $1,200, depending on the extent of the issue. Minor repairs, such as replacing a damaged inverter component, may be closer to the lower end of this range. More extensive repairs involving panel replacements tend to be at the higher end.
Factors Influencing Cost - The total expense can vary based on system size, complexity, and the specific repairs needed. For example, fixing a single malfunctioning panel might cost around $200, while repairing multiple components could reach $2,000 or more. Local service providers can provide detailed estimates based on the situation.
Average Service Fees - Many service providers charge between $100 and $300 for diagnostic assessments before repairs. Labor costs for repairs typically add another $150 to $600, depending on the difficulty and parts required. These estimates help gauge the typical investment for photovoltaic system repairs.
Additional Cost Considerations - Replacement parts, such as inverters or panels, can significantly influence overall costs, with parts ranging from $100 to over $1,000 each. Costs may also increase if extensive troubleshooting or multiple repairs are necessary, emphasizing the importance of consulting local pros for accurate estimates.
Actual totals will depend on details like access to the work area, the scope of the project, and the materials selected, so use these as general starting points rather than exact figures.
